Warning Signs You Need Shower Leak Water Removal

Catching shower le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. But how do you know when it’s time to call a professional?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your shower or bathroom can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ore these odors, as they can lead to mold and mildew growth, which can spread to other areas of your home. Act quickly, prevent mold and mildew.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t delay repairs, as these stains can spread and cause further damage. Address the issue before it’s too late.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t try to fix the issue yourself, as this can lead to further damage and safety hazards. Call a professional to assess and repair the damage.

Increased Water Bills

Unexpected increases in your water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ore these changes, as they can lead to significant financial losses. Investigate the issue and address it quickly.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as standing water or water-soaked materials, is a clear sign that you need professional help. Don’t try to clean up the damage yourself, as this can lead to further damage and safety hazards. Call a professional to assess and repair the damage.

Shower Leak Water Removal Cost in Kathleen, GA

The cost of shower leak water removal in Kathleen, GA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, amount of water extracted
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Leak Repair and Restoration $2,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ed
Shower Rebuild and Reconstruction $3,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of materials used
Insurance Claims Help $0 – $1,000 Complexity of claims process, number of claims filed

Common Questions About Shower Leak Water Removal

How long does it take to dry a shower after a leak?

We use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and drying equipment to remove moisture from the affected area. Drying times can vary depending on the size of the affected area and the type of materials used. On average, it takes 3-5 days to completely dry a shower after a leak. Fast drying, reduced risk of mold and mildew.

Can I use bleach to clean up water damage?

No, bleach is not recommended for cleaning up water damage. Bleach can damage surfaces, discolor materials, and create new safety hazards. Instead, we use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to safely and effectively clean up water damage. Safe and effective cleaning, guaranteed.

How do I prevent future shower leaks?

Preventing future shower leaks need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your showerhead and faucet regularly for signs of wear and tear, and replace them as needed. Also, ensure that your shower is properly ventilated to prevent moisture buildup. Preventative maintenance, peace of mind.
